Identify a Damaged Charging Port The first sign of a damaged charging port is that the connection is loose when plugging in the cable. If you have to adjust the cable way too often to get the iPhone to charge, then it is a clear indication of internal damage. Another common sign is intermittent charging, in which the device starts and stops charging on its own.
